A MAN has been arrested and charged after a reportedly stolen car crashed into several parked vehicles in Port Glasgow.

Emergency services rushed to Castlehill Avenue after receiving a report of the incident at around 8:20pm last night.

Police say the 29-year-old driver of the car made off following the smash but was traced a short time afterwards.

He was taken to hospital for treatment by ambulance and was later arrested and charged in connection with the incident.

Images circulating on social media following the collision showed a red Suzuki car having smashed through a garden fence and gone over a ledge before coming to rest in an almost vertical position.

A Police Scotland spokesperson said: "Around 8.20pm on Sunday, 12 November, 2023, we were made aware of a crash involving a car and a number of parked vehicles on Castlehill Avenue, Port Glasgow.

"Emergency services attended.

"The 29-year-old driver of the car made off but was traced a short time later and taken to hospital for treatment.

"He was also arrested and charged in connection with the incident.

"A report will be submitted to the Procurator Fiscal."

A Scottish Fire and Rescue Service spokesperson said: “We were called to assist emergency service partners at a road traffic collision involving one vehicle and three unoccupied vehicles on Castlehill Avenue, Port Glasgow, on Sunday, 12 November at 8.16pm.

“Operations Control mobilised four appliances to the scene to assist in making the area safe.

“One casualty was in the care of the Scottish Ambulance Service.”
